Date: Mon, 24 Oct 2016 01:29:46 +0000 (UTC) From: Mark Johnston <markj@FreeBSD.org> To: src-committers@freebsd.org, svn-src-all@freebsd.org, svn-src-stable@freebsd.org, svn-src-stable-11@freebsd.org Subject: svn commit: r307837 - in stable/11/sys/cddl/dev/fbt: . arm powerpc x86 Message-ID: <201610240129.u9O1Tkco062037@repo.freebsd.org>
next in thread | raw e-mail | index | archive | help
Author: markj Date: Mon Oct 24 01:29:46 2016 New Revision: 307837 URL: https://svnweb.freebsd.org/changeset/base/307837 Log: MFC r306570: Allow tracing of functions prefixed by "__". Modified: stable/11/sys/cddl/dev/fbt/arm/fbt_isa.c stable/11/sys/cddl/dev/fbt/fbt.c stable/11/sys/cddl/dev/fbt/powerpc/fbt_isa.c stable/11/sys/cddl/dev/fbt/x86/fbt_isa.c Directory Properties: stable/11/ (props changed) Modified: stable/11/sys/cddl/dev/fbt/arm/fbt_isa.c ============================================================================== --- stable/11/sys/cddl/dev/fbt/arm/fbt_isa.c Mon Oct 24 01:22:01 2016 (r307836) +++ stable/11/sys/cddl/dev/fbt/arm/fbt_isa.c Mon Oct 24 01:29:46 2016 (r307837) @@ -106,9 +106,6 @@ fbt_provide_module_function(linker_file_ return (0); } - if (name[0] == '_' && name[1] == '_') - return (0); - instr = (uint32_t *)symval->value; limit = (uint32_t *)(symval->value + symval->size); Modified: stable/11/sys/cddl/dev/fbt/fbt.c ============================================================================== --- stable/11/sys/cddl/dev/fbt/fbt.c Mon Oct 24 01:22:01 2016 (r307836) +++ stable/11/sys/cddl/dev/fbt/fbt.c Mon Oct 24 01:29:46 2016 (r307837) @@ -126,10 +126,6 @@ fbt_excluded(const char *name) return (1); } - /* Exclude some internal functions */ - if (name[0] == '_' && name[1] == '_') - return (1); - /* * When DTrace is built into the kernel we need to exclude * the FBT functions from instrumentation. Modified: stable/11/sys/cddl/dev/fbt/powerpc/fbt_isa.c ============================================================================== --- stable/11/sys/cddl/dev/fbt/powerpc/fbt_isa.c Mon Oct 24 01:22:01 2016 (r307836) +++ stable/11/sys/cddl/dev/fbt/powerpc/fbt_isa.c Mon Oct 24 01:29:46 2016 (r307837) @@ -138,9 +138,6 @@ fbt_provide_module_function(linker_file_ return (0); } - if (name[0] == '_' && name[1] == '_') - return (0); - instr = (uint32_t *) symval->value; limit = (uint32_t *) (symval->value + symval->size); Modified: stable/11/sys/cddl/dev/fbt/x86/fbt_isa.c ============================================================================== --- stable/11/sys/cddl/dev/fbt/x86/fbt_isa.c Mon Oct 24 01:22:01 2016 (r307836) +++ stable/11/sys/cddl/dev/fbt/x86/fbt_isa.c Mon Oct 24 01:29:46 2016 (r307837) @@ -174,9 +174,6 @@ fbt_provide_module_function(linker_file_ return (0); } - if (name[0] == '_' && name[1] == '_') - return (0); - size = symval->size; instr = (uint8_t *) symval->value;
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201610240129.u9O1Tkco062037>